In the industrial production process, carbon steel tube heat exchangers are widely used equipment. Its unit volume of equipment can provide a large heat transfer area and good heat transfer performance. It is mainly composed of shell, tube plate, heat exchange tube, head, baffle, etc. Because the equipment has a compact structure and can be made of a variety of materials, it has strong adaptability and is widely used in large-scale installations and high temperatures and high pressures. Therefore, we must do daily maintenance work:
1. Carefully check the operating parameters of the equipment. Over-temperature and over-voltage are strictly prohibited.
2, Operators should strictly abide by the operating procedures, conduct regular inspections of the equipment, and check whether the foundation supports are stable and the equipment leaks, etc.
3, Keep bolts tight and valves, pressure gauges and other facilities intact.
4. When using equipment belonging to pressure vessels, the following points should be done during daily maintenance:
(1) Operators should be certified to work. The user unit should conduct regular training and education for pressure vessel operators.
(2) Pressure vessel files must be established and kept by the management department. And it should be clearly stated in the process operating procedures and job operating procedures.
Carbon steel tube heat exchangeroperating requirements. Its content includes at least the following points:
a.Equipment operating process indicators.
b.Equipment operating methods.
c.Items and parts that should be inspected during equipment operation, abnormal phenomena that may occur during operation and avoidance measures, as well as emergency handling and reporting procedures.
(3) When one of the following abnormal phenomena is discovered, the operator should take emergency measures promptly and follow the prescribed reporting procedures.
a.When the working pressure and medium temperature of the equipment exceed the specified values, effective control cannot be achieved even if measures are taken.
b.The main pressure-bearing components of the equipment may suffer from dangerous phenomena such as cracks, bulges, deformation, and leakage.
c.Safety attachment failed.
d.The pipes and fasteners are damaged, making it difficult to ensure safe operation.
e.The carbon steel tube heat exchanger and pipes vibrated severely, endangering safe operation.
f.Other abnormal situations.
5, Keep the equipment and surrounding environment clean.
